I've taken the time to write out the levels of each type of vitamin because that was something I wanted to know before purchasing. Please note they might occasionally change their formula but this is from the label of the vitamins I bought in late 2011: Vitamin A - 4000IU - 80% (from Beta Carotene) Vitamin A - 6000IU - 120% (from Retinyl palminate) Vitamin C - 150 mg - 250% (from ascorbic acid) Vitamin D - 400 IU - 100% (from cholecalciferol) Vitamin E - 100% IU - 333% (from d-alpha tocopheryl acid succinate) Thiamin - 25 mg - 1667% (from thiamin mononitrate) Riboflavin - 25 mg - 1471% Niacin - 100 mg - 500% (from niacinamide) Vitamin B6 - 1250% (from pyridoxine hydrochloride) Folic Acid - 800 mcg - 200% Vitamin B12 - 100 mcg - 1667% (from cynocobalamin) Biotin - 300 mcg - 100% Pantothenic Acid - 50 mg - 500% (from d-calcium pantothenate) Calcium - 25 mg - 3% (from calcium carbonate and calcium citrate) Iron - 10 mg - 56% (from carbonyl iron) Iodine - 150 mcg - 100% (from potassium iodine) Magnesium - 7.2 mg - 2% (from magnesium oxide and magnesium aspartate) Zinc - 15 mg - 100% (from zinc picolinate) Selenium - 200 mcg - 286% (from sodium selenate) Copper - 2 mg - 100% (from copper gluconate) Manganese - 5mg - 200% (from manganese gluconate) Chromium - 200 mcg - 167% (from chromium chloride) Molybdenum - 150 mcg - 200% (from sodium molybdate) Choline - 10 mg - + (from choline bitartrate) Inositol - 10 mg - + FloraGLO Lutein - 500 mct - + + = Daily Value (DV) not established Other ingredients: Gelatin, Purified Water, Alginic Acid, Croscarmellose Sodium, Potassium Citrate, Soy Lecithin, MCT, Magnesium Silicate, Vegetable Stearic Acid, Silica, Magnesium Stearate, Potassium Aspartate. 1 per day = recommended dose

Solid Multi Without Pseudoscience
The best source of minerals and vitamins is food. But unfortunately today's food supply consists of staple foods like grains, soy, and legumes that contain phytic acid, which strongly inhibits mineral absorption. Livestock is fed corn rather than their evolutionary diets, leading to poor mineral content in meat. Produce may not be as mineral dense as it was decades ago. So it makes sense to supplement. This is a solid vitamin from what I can tell. It doesn't have herbs that have little to no controlled studies to prove their efficacy or characterize their side effects. It doesn't insult your intelligence by including a list of amino acids that compose complete proteins that you already are getting enough of. But it isn't perfect. Some improvements I'd like to see: 1. Bump the 400 IU of vitamin D to 5000 IU if vitamin D3. Studies within the last 5 years have shown that vitamin D3 is a pro-hormone needed to balance the immune system, and that because we live inside, wear clothes, etc we do not manufacture enough from sunlight. Studies show *correlation* (not proven causation) of vitamin D levels reducing the risk of cancer. Taking an evolutionary approach, look at the tight correlation of skin tone and UV index rays of native people. It suggests that vitamin D levels are an extremely important variable in natural selection so much so that it has occurred since humans have left Africa. 2. Replace vitamin K with vitamin K2. K2 is a form of vitamin K that your body can actually use. It comes from probiotic bacteria cultures that we don't get anymore. Fermented foods, raw milk, yogurt. 3. Up the magnesium, but in the form of magnesium citrate so you don't have a laxative side effect.
